10 tips to save on your Carnegie Mellon University car hire

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le type and features. Whether you need an SUV for added space, a convertible for summer enjoyment, or an economy car for budget-friendly options,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the best fit for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to secure your vehicle well ahead of your trip. By booking early, you're likely to obtain lower rates and enjoy a wider selection, particularly during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ller cars typically come with lower rental fees and are eas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als offer a good balance of affordability,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ers younger than 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ily fees, and certain vehicle types—such as SUVs or premium models—might not be available. This may also apply to renters over 70 years old. Always verify the age restrictions before making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rental companies operate on a full-to-full fuel policy, which requires you to return the vehicle with a full tank to avoid extra charges. This is usually the most favorable option. Others may offer full-to-empty or prepaid fueling alternatives, which are also acceptable; just ensure you return the car empty in that case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but this might be worthwhile for the added convenience it provides.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and offers peace of mind if something unforeseen occurs during your trip. It's simple to add car rental insurance when booking through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ning extensive road trips, seek out rentals with unlimited mileage to prevent additional char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a vehicle.
